My marriage to David began eighteen years ago under difficult circumstances. His ex-wife, Emily, had left him and their children for another man. Emily and David shared two wonderful kids, a boy and a girl. When their children were just three and four years old, David lost his job, which led to a tough period for the family. While Emily was struggling to find work and support the children, David sought solace in drinking and often complained about his situation to his mates. During this challenging time, Emilys new partner started pursuing her, and overwhelmed by financial stress and emotional turmoil, she eventually left her husband and children to be with her new partner.

As a result, the children were left to fend for themselves. Our caring neighbours stepped in, offering them food and support. Meanwhile, David didnt even notice when his wife left, lost in his own troubles. By the time he realised what had happened, it was too latethe children had been sent to a childrens home.

I entered Davids life when we met at a mutual friends wedding. His situation touched my heart, and I felt an immediate connection to him. I decided to help change his outlook on life and support him through his emotional challenges. After the wedding, I volunteered to bring the children home from the children’s home. Although I couldnt have children of my own, I felt a deep affection for them and treated them as if they were my own from the very beginning. They, too, loved me as their mother.

For eighteen years, the children had no idea that I wasnt their biological mum. Suddenly, Emily reappeared, eager to reconnect with her kids and reveal the truth about their parentage. The boy took the news calmly, saying I was the only mother hed ever known and never doubted it. The girl was more receptive to her biological mum and chose to forgive her. At first, I was hesitant to let Emily back into their lives, as her past actions had caused the children so much pain. However, I realised she felt genuine remorse and wanted to make amends with them.

In time, I understood that having two loving and caring mothers was a blessing for the children. I chose to support Emilys efforts to rebuild her relationship with them, recognising that being a mother is not just about giving birth, but about raising children with love and care.
